Antique Highlight: Pump from Normandy

This week at French Metro Antiques, we are featuring this late nineteenth century cast iron water pump.

Nineteenth Century PumpThis piece was found on a farm in Normandy, France and has an aged blue painted patina. Originally standing in the center of a French village, this pump would have been used by the entire community to collect water for their homes for cooking, cleaning, etc. The village fountain was a focal point in France providing a meeting place for villagers to gather and exchange gossip. 

Nineteenth Century PumpThis fountain here is detailed with a dolphin’s head at the spout, as well as flowers on the sides.

Nineteenth Century Pump

Originally it would have functioned by pumping the lever.

Nineteenth Century PumpAlthough this one no longer functions as a pump, it could easily be adapted to have water cycle through it as a fountain!
